3. Real Estate Market

The real estate market in Mullins stands out for its remarkable accessibility and value. With a median home value of approximately $146,800, homeownership is an attainable dream for many first-time buyers, growing families, and downsizers alike. The housing stock primarily consists of single-family homes, often featuring generous lots, mature trees, and a mix of classic and modern architectural styles.

This attractive pricing, combined with the area's median household income of around $47,414, creates a stable and sustainable housing environment. The market tends to be less volatile than in major metropolitan areas, making Mullins an excellent choice for those seeking long-term stability and a solid investment in a close-knit community without the premium price tag.

Mullins Market Data

MetricValueSource
Median Home Price$147KU.S. Census ACS 2022
Median Gross Rent$835/moU.S. Census ACS 2022
Median Household Income$47KU.S. Census ACS 2022
Homeownership Rate59.9%U.S. Census ACS 2022
Renter-Occupied40.1%U.S. Census ACS 2022
Rental Vacancy Rate9.0%U.S. Census ACS 2022
Market TypeBuyer'sU.S. Census ACS 2022
